Trade paperback. Second novel, third book, by this highly praised young writer. This story of a cellist, a child prodigy who loses his gift abruptly at age 18, and 17 years later finds his life once again unexpectedly disrupted, is a brief but powerful novel. Salzman himself plays the cello. 284 pp. Very near fine (usual light toning to the pages.).
